Summary of differences between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ried and Foie gras

  • The amount of Vitamin B12, Vitamin A RAE, Vitamin B2, Vitamin B5, Folate, Iron, Selenium, and Vitamin B3 in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ried is higher than in Foie gras.
  •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ried covers your daily need of Vitamin B12 489% more than Foie gras.
  •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ried contains 9 times more Folate than Foie gras. While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ried contains 560µg of Folate, Foie gras contains only 60µg.
  • The amount of Cholesterol in Foie gras is lower.

These are the specific foods used in this comparison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ried and Pate de foie gras, canned (goose liver pate), smoked.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ried Foie gras Opinion
Net carbs 1.11g 4.67g Foie gras
Protein 25.78g 11.4g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Fats 6.43g 43.84g Foie gras
Carbs 1.11g 4.67g Foie gras
Calories 172kcal 462kcal Foie gras
Calcium 10mg 70mg Foie gras
Iron 12.88mg 5.5m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Magnesium 27mg 13m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Phosphorus 442mg 200m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Potassium 315mg 138m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Sodium 92mg 697m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Zinc 4.01mg 0.92m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Copper 0.535mg 0.4m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Manganese 0.375mg 0.12m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Selenium 88.2µg 44µg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in A 14378IU 3333IU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in A RAE 4296µg 1001µg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in E 0.77m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in C 2.7mg 2m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in B1 0.292mg 0.088m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in B2 2.313mg 0.299m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in B3 13.925mg 2.51m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in B5 8.315mg 1.2m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in B6 0.84mg 0.06m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Folate 560µg 60µg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Vitamin B12 21.13µg 9.4µg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Tryptophan 0.261mg 0.161m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Threonine 1.076mg 0.507m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Isoleucine 1.206mg 0.606m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Leucine 2.243mg 1.029m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Lysine 1.976mg 0.863m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Methionine 0.641mg 0.27m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Phenylalanine 1.223mg 0.567m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Valine 1.481mg 0.719m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Histidine 0.752mg 0.303mg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Cholesterol 564mg 150mg Foie gras
Trans Fat 0.098g Foie gras
Saturated Fat 2.033g 14.45g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
Monounsaturated Fat 1.387g 25.61g Foie gras
Polyunsaturated fat 1.265g 0.84g Chicken, liver, all classes, cooked, pan-fried
